Hướng dẫn dịch Đại hội thể thao Châu Á được tổ chức bốn năm một lần nhằm mục đích phát triển sự giao lưu giữa các nền văn hóa và tình hữu nghị giữa các quốc gia Châu Á. Trong sự kiện có nhiều môn thể thao này, những người trẻ tuổi ở khắp Châu Á tụ họp để cùng tranh tài. Nó là cơ hội để kiểm định tài năng thể thao và sức mạnh, để xây dựng và củng cố tình hữu nghị và đoàn kết. Suốt năm thập kỷ lịch sử, Á vận hội đã tiến bộ về nhiều phương diện. Số lượng người tham dự đã tăng lên. Chất lượng của các vận động viên, nhân viên và các phương tiện thể thao cũng đã được phát triển dần. Các môn thể thao mới và các môn thể thao theo truyền thống đều được giới thiệu và đưa thêm vào Thế vận hội. Á vận hội lần thứ nhất 1951 được tổ chức tại New Delhi, Án Độ chỉ có 489 vận động viên từ 11 quốc gia tham dự. Sáu môn thi đấu mà các vận động viên tham gia là bóng rổ, đua xe đạp, bóng đá, môn thể thao dưới nước, điền kinh và cử tạ. Môn đấu quyền anh, bắn súng và đấu vật được thêm vào ở Á vận hội lần thứ hai ở Manila, Phi-lip-pin năm 1954; môn quần vợt, bóng chuyền, bóng bàn và khúc côn cầu được thêm vào Á vận hội lần thứ ba tại Tokyo, Nhật năm 1958. Môn bóng quần, bóng bầu dục, đấu kiếm và xe đạp leo núi được đưa vào thi đấu lần đầu tiên ở Á vận hội thứ 13 tại Bangkok, Thái Lan năm 1998. Á vận hội lần thứ 14 được tổ chức ở Busan, Hàn Quốc năm 2002 đã thu hút 9 919 vận động viên tham dự từ 42 quốc gia. Các vận động viên tranh tài trong 38 môn thể thao và đạt 419 huy chương vàng. Vận động viên Việt Nam tham dự vào sự kiện thể thao này với sự nhiệt tình lớn lao. Nỗ lực của họ được đánh giá cao khi họ đạt được hai huy chương vàng cho môn thể hình và billards, và hai huy chương vàng khác cho môn karate nữ. Hy vọng rằng trong tương lai sắp tới Việt Nam sẽ là quốc gia đăng cai thế vận hội và sẽ đạt được nhiều huy chương hơn nữa trong các môn thi đấu khác. Task 1. I know the man ____ Miss White is talking himB. whichC. whoseD. ΦIV. Read the passage carefully and choose the correct Asian Games owes gains its origins to small Asian multi-sport competitions. The Far Eastern Championship Games were created to show unity and cooperation among three nations Japan, the Philippines and China. The first games were held in Manila, the Philippines in 1931. Other Asian nations participated after they were World War II, a number of Asian countries became independent. Many of the new independent Asian countries wanted to use a new type of competition where Asian dominance authority. should not be shown by violence and should be strengthened by mutual understanding. In August 1948, during the 14th Olympic Game in London, India representative Guru Dutt Sondhi proposed to sports leaders of the Asian teams the idea of having discussions about holding the Asian Games. They agreed to form the Asian Athletic Federation. A preparatory was set up to draft the charter for the Asian amateur athletic federation. In February, 1949, the Asian athletic federation was formed and used the name Asian Games Federation. It was formed and used the name Asian Games Federation. It was decided to hold the first Asian Games in 1951 in New Delhi, the capital of India. It is often said that books are always a good friends and reading is an active mental process. Unlike TV, books make you use your brain. By reading, you think more and become smarter. Reading improves concentration and focus. Reading books takes brain power. It requires you to focus on what you are reading for long periods. Unlike magazines, Internet posts or e-Mails that might contain small pieces of information. Books tell the whole story". Since you must concentrate in order to read, you will get better at concentration. Many studies show if you do not use your memory; you lose it. Reading helps you stretch your memory muscles. Reading requires remembering details, facts and figures and in literature, plot lines, themes and characters. Reading is a good way to improve your vocabulary. Do you remember that when you were at elementary school you learned how to infer the meaning of one word by reading the context of the other words in the sentence? While reading books, especially challenging ones, you will find yourself exposed to many new words. Reading is a fundamental skill builder. Every good course has a matching book to go with it. Why? Because books help clarify difficult subjects. Books provide information that goes deeper than just classroom discussions By reading more books you become better informed and more of an expert on the topics you read about. This expertise translates into higher self-esteem. Since you are so well-read, people look to you for answers. Your feelings about yourself can only get better. Books give you knowledge of other cultures and places. The more information you have got, the richer your knowledge is. Books can expand your horizons by letting you see what other cities and countries have to offer before you visit them. 36. Books have great influence on ________. a. First of all, you have to read the book. Your next step will be to organize what you are going to say about it in your report. Writing the basic elements down in an outline format will help you to organize your thoughts. What will you include in the outline? Follow whatever instructions your teacher has given you. If you are on your own, however, the following guidelines should help. Let's assume for the moment that you have chosen a work of fiction. We will start with a description of the book. The description should include such elements as 1. The setting Where does the story take place? Is it a real place or an imaginary one? If the author does not tell you exactly, where the story is set, what can you tell about it from the way it is described? 2. The time period Is the story set in the present day or in an earlier time period? Perhaps it is even set in the future! Let your reader know. 3. The main characters Who is the story mostly about? Give a brief description. Often, one character can be singled out as the main character, but some books will have more than one. 4. The plot What happens to the main character? Warning! Be careful here. Do not fall into the boring trap of reporting every single thing that happens in the story. Pick only the most important events. Here are some hints on how to do that. First, explain the situation of the main character as the story opens. Next, identify the basic plot element of the story - Is the main character trying to achieve something or overcome a particular problem? Thirdly, describe a few of the more important things that happen to the main character as he/she works toward that goal or solution. Finally, you might hint at the story's conclusion without completely giving away the ending. The four points above deal with the report aspect of your work. For the final section of your outline, give your reader a sense of the impression the book made upon you. Ask yourself what the author was trying to achieve and whether or not he achieved it with you. What larger idea does the story illustrate? How does it do that? How did you feel about the author's style of writing, the setting, or the mood of the novel? You do not have to limit yourself to these areas. Pick something which caught your attention, and let your reader know your personal response to whatever it was. 36.
